Reasons For Structure Cracks
To appreciate the frequency of this issue in contemporary structures, consider these significant causes:

Water
This is the most significant danger to your foundation and by extension to your costly investment. Water pressure can either be up, better known as hydrostatic pressure, or inward, which is technically referred to as lateral pressure, against your foundation walls.
Too much water in the soil around a structure causes swelling hence pushing versus the wall. This soil pressure triggers splitting which threatens your home. Pipes leaks, bad roof drain and bad grading are amongst main causes of excess water.

Poor Structure Compaction
If the structure concrete was laid unprofessionally and the soil around it received inadequate compaction, your home will settle unevenly. The result of such oversight is shifting of your foundation causing fractures due to insufficient assistance.

Kind of Soil
Expansive soils and clay soils are very unforeseeable for structure building and construction. There are significant modifications after the structure is laid with clay spoils expanding in case of excessive moisture and shrinking, significantly causing structure settling. Heaving and combination soils will cause structure cracks depending upon moisture levels.

Tree Roots
If your home is next to a huge tree or bushes, it is most likely their roots will apply fantastic pressure on the structure resulting in hair fractures. It is important to keep in mind that roots can grow as far away as the height of the tree, which means no tree needs to be close to your foundation.

Dry spell
This is an overlooked reason for foundation issue. After all, who can associate lack of water in the soil as a foundation threat? Well, when moisture dries entirely from the soil, shrinkage takes place leaving a gap between the structure and compacted soil. This enables structure movement and ultimately fractures.

Extremes in soil moisture levels
The soil surrounding your foundation plays a substantial role in supporting your structure. Soil broadens when moisture is contributed to it and diminishes when moisture is eliminated. In times of dry spell, soil will shrink away from the structure leaving a space. In times of heavy rainfall, the soil will broaden and push against the structure applying more pressure on it. Conclusively, these shifts are what cause fractures in the structure.

Severe heat
In hot seasons, the concrete foundation will expand when it is exposed to heat. Thankfully, when the sun has actually set and the night is cool, the concrete will contract back to its initial position. Nevertheless, in such environments where extreme heat is a normal incident, these modifications can lead to fractures in the foundation.



Faulty plumbing
Additionally, it is essential to guarantee that your pipes aren't leaking. Leaking pipelines can include wetness to the soil surrounding the foundation of your home causing it to broaden and apply pressure on your structure.

Earthquakes
When earthquakes happen, they shake the foundation of the home, causing fractures and structure dripping. This particularly happens in foundations that are not well supported or steady. With time, the structure compromises as the earth around it is dismembered by the quake. Ultimately, the amount of damage to the structure will depend upon the get more info magnitude of the earthquake.

Although foundations are designed to be resistant, with time they do wear down. Just as people adopt wrinkles on their confront with age, likewise imperfections start to appear in our foundations. If you have a concrete foundation, you are most likely to come across fractures at some time.

Cracks in concrete structures are a typical occurrence. In addition, fractures appear as concrete diminishes and expands in reaction to modifications in humidity and temperature in the environment. It is necessary to understand the underlying cause of the fractures in your structure in order to apply the right structure leaking repair work strategy.
